![]() ![]() ![]() Note that Chrome Remote Desktop uses a unique protocol, as opposed to using the common Remote Desktop Protocol (developed by Microsoft ). This feature, therefore, consists of a server component for the host computer, and a client component on the computer accessing the remote server. ![]() The protocol transmits the keyboard and mouse events from the client to the server, relaying the graphical screen updates back in the other direction over a computer network. ChromeOS, Linux (beta), macOS, iOS, Windows, AndroidĬhrome Remote Desktop is a remote desktop software tool, developed by Google, that allows a user to remotely control another computer's desktop through a proprietary protocol also developed by Google, internally called Chromoting. ![]()
